Letting your dog outside sounds simple.

But depending on your home and schedule, it can become surprisingly complicated.

I tested three different solutions to see which worked best.


Option 1: Manual Door Access

This is the traditional method—opening the door whenever your dog asks.

While simple, it quickly becomes disruptive.

Dogs often ask to go outside dozens of times per day.


Option 2: Hiring Help

Some people hire dog walkers or search for services like "dog walkers near me," "dog daycare," or "dog kennels near me."

While helpful, these options involve recurring costs and scheduling logistics.


Option 3: Installing an Automatic Pet Door

The most reliable solution turned out to be installing an automatic dog door.

This allowed my dog to move freely between indoors and outdoors without constant supervision.

A smart dog door with collar recognition ensures only my dog can activate it.

The result is a much calmer household.

Instead of waiting by the door, my dog simply uses the door whenever he wants.
